Output d91f458edcc97e069548212758607def8cb9ec333da210b3bea62f6b1699db73:11

value
9246396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3061283b2e3b3de2b47e2ffc9481a304b40b6ba2 OP_EQUAL
address
366pkMC8NutKSySLzvi1DF5oetpqEXGj5o
transaction
d91f458edcc97e069548212758607def8cb9ec333da210b3bea62f6b1699db73
spent
true